Cingal Information

Cingal (Sodium Hyaluronate/Triamcinolone Hexacetonide) is used to provide pain relief for people with osteoarthritis knee pain. Stiffness and pain are common symptoms of knee osteoarthritis. It may affect one knee or both. Age, obesity, genetics, occupation, diet, and injuries are risk factors for osteoarthritis of the knee. Viscosupplementation agents like Sodium Hyaluronate provide long-term pain relief in the knee joint by acting as a lubricant and shock absorber. Corticosteroids like Triamcinolone Hexacetonide work by reducing inflammation and swelling in the knee joint for short-term pain relief.

Cingal Side Effects

The most common side effects of Cingal may include mild pain; temporary swelling; bruising at injection site; heat; Call your doctor right away if you have any of the serious side effects, such as:
• Color changes at the injection site;
• Difficulty moving;
• Muscle pain or stiffness;
• Signs of an infection such as fever, increased redness, and swelling at the injection site;
• Thinner skin

Cingal Precautions

Do not use Cingal if you are allergic to Sodium Hyaluronate, Triamcinolone Hexacetonide or other ingredients in this medication. Before you start using this medication, tell your doctor about your medical history, including if you have allergies; have infections at the site where the injection is to be given; have kidney problems; have impaired cardio-renal function; have a disease where the use of corticosteroid is warned; think you may be pregnant or plan to become pregnant; are breastfeeding, or are planning to breastfeed. Tell your doctor about all the medications you take, including prescription, OTC, herbal supplements, and vitamins. There may be a drug interaction between Cingal and other medications, like disinfectants containing quaternary ammonium salts for skin preparation;. Do not use Cingal if you are pregnant or planning to become pregnant without informing your doctor. It is not known if this medication will harm your unborn baby. Do not use Cingal while breastfeeding without talking to your doctor. It is unknown whether Sodium Hyaluronate or Triamcinolone Hexacetonide passes into your breastmilk or if they may harm nursing infants. It is not known if this drug is safe for use in children. It may harm them. Use your medicine exactly as prescribed by your doctor. Cingal injection should be administered by a health care professional into your knee joint. Do not strain your knee joint for at least 2 days after receiving the injection. Avoid activities such as heavy lifting, jogging, tennis, or standing on your feet for a long time. You may experience temporary pain and swelling at the injection site for 2 to 4 days after receiving the injection. You can apply ice to the swollen region for the first 24 hours. Wrap the ice in a cloth and apply to the swollen region for 20 minutes on and then 20 minutes off to decrease pain. You may use heat after 24 hours. Store Cingal in its original package at room temperature. Do not freeze.
